one of the greatest tracks in the whole mega man franchise was the first wily stage theme in Mega Man 2
around 2007 there was a japanese meme that spread on nico nico douga. it was a song set to this track. it's called Omoide wa Okkusenman! (Countless Memories! or more literally 110 Million Memories!) that got various versions versions. it's not a funny meme, it's a song about growing up and losing childhood wonder. here's the song with the animation that was made for it with an english translation at the bottom but you should also hear the jam project version
in 2012, Sound Holic made an official album of remixes for mega man's 25th anniversary called Rockman Holic. this includes a remix of this track with english lyrics called Together As One. the lyrics are clearly related to Omoide wa Okkusenman! but i'm always interpreted it as a response to that song. here's a version of the whole song with lyrics
